引言

在《七骑士2》这款游戏中,前期角色的设计往往充满了神秘感,吸引着玩家一步步深入探索。本文将揭开这些角色的神秘面纱,带玩家一同走进他们的起源世界。

角色背景介绍

1. 艾尔文

艾尔文是游戏中的主要角色之一,他是一个勇敢的战士。他的背景故事揭示了他在一次战斗中失去了记忆,被一位神秘的老人收养,并传授了他战斗的技巧。

艾尔文的起源: 艾尔文原本是某个国家的王子,因国家发生战乱而被迫离开家园。在逃亡过程中,他被一位隐居的剑术大师所救,并在此学习了剑术。

2. 莉莉丝

莉莉丝是一名神秘的女巫,她拥有强大的魔法力量。她的故事始于一个古老的预言,预言中提到她会拯救世界。

莉莉丝的起源: 莉莉丝出生于一个古老的魔法世家,她的家族拥有悠久的历史和强大的魔法传承。然而,在她很小的时候,家族遭遇了一场灾难,她被迫流亡。

3. 瑞恩

瑞恩是一名勇敢的弓箭手,他擅长远程攻击。他的故事起始于一个边境小村庄,他一直渴望成为一名英雄。

瑞恩的起源: 瑞恩出生于一个边境小村庄,他的父亲是一名猎人和弓箭手。从小,瑞恩就跟随父亲学习箭术,立志成为一名英雄。

角色能力分析

1. 艾尔文

艾尔文擅长近战攻击,具有较高的物理攻击力和防御力。他的技能可以造成大量物理伤害,同时具备一定的治疗能力。

<code>
public class Elwin {
    private int attackPower;
    private int defensePower;
    private int healPower;

    public Elwin(int attackPower, int defensePower, int healPower) {
        this.attackPower = attackPower;
        this.defensePower = defensePower;
        this.healPower = healPower;
    }

    public void attack() {
        // 执行攻击操作
        System.out.println("艾尔文发动攻击,造成" + attackPower + "点伤害");
    }

    public void defend() {
        // 执行防御操作
        System.out.println("艾尔文成功防御");
    }

    public void heal() {
        // 执行治疗操作
        System.out.println("艾尔文为自己治疗" + healPower + "点生命值");
    }
}
</code>

2. 莉莉丝

莉莉丝擅长使用魔法攻击,具有高魔法攻击力和较低的物理防御力。她的技能可以造成大量魔法伤害,同时具备一定的辅助能力。

<code>
public class Lilies {
    private int magicAttackPower;
    private int magicDefensePower;

    public Lilies(int magicAttackPower, int magicDefensePower) {
        this.magicAttackPower = magicAttackPower;
        this.magicDefensePower = magicDefensePower;
    }

    public void magicAttack() {
        // 执行魔法攻击操作
        System.out.println("莉莉丝发动魔法攻击,造成" + magicAttackPower + "点伤害");
    }

    public void assist() {
        // 执行辅助操作
        System.out.println("莉莉丝使用辅助技能");
    }
}
</code>

3. 瑞恩

瑞恩擅长远程攻击,具有较高的物理攻击力和较低的防御力。他的技能可以造成大量物理伤害,同时具备一定的控制能力。

<code>
public class Ryan {
    private int attackPower;
    private int defensePower;

    public Ryan(int attackPower, int defensePower) {
        this.attackPower = attackPower;
        this.defensePower = defensePower;
    }

    public void attack() {
        // 执行攻击操作
        System.out.println("瑞恩发动攻击,造成" + attackPower + "点伤害");
    }

    public void control() {
        // 执行控制操作
        System.out.println("瑞恩使用控制技能");
    }
}
</code>

总结

通过对《七骑士2》前期角色的背景介绍和能力分析,玩家可以更好地了解这些角色的特点,为后续的游戏过程做好准备。同时,这些角色的故事也丰富了游戏的背景世界,让玩家沉浸其中。